RETURN PROCESS — LEASED LAPTOPS (Brightlane lease pool)

1. Wipe confirmation slip must be stapled to each unit bag.
2. Pack max ten laptops per tote; foam dividers mandatory.
3. Log serials against the Brightlane manifest before sealing.
4. Damaged units go in the red tote with an incident slip.
5. Stage totes at dock 2 by 09:00; Farrow Freight collects same day.

Shift lead verifies count and seals personally. The confidential courier hand-over instruction is appended below.

handover note for yagef-bagep: the drudor pelius courier leaves the kasdor zorvan norir ledger at gate 8016 under passcode 755406

Ticket: Per-tenant rate quotas are leaking across tenants again. Heads up on-call — the Quotaledger cache keys are being built without the tenant prefix after last week's refactor, so tenant Marbury is eating tenant Oskfell's quota. You'll see 429s from tenants who are nowhere near their limits. Quick mitigation: flush the quota cache and roll back the limiter pod to the previous image. Fix is in review. The bad deploy's trace token is pasted below so you can match it in the logs.

session token of tajef-bageg = htk21_5d90d574934f3ccae6437

**Ticket: Config drift on BounceSift processor**

The email bounce processor in the Larkfield environment has drifted from the values committed in the release branch. Retry windows and suppression thresholds no longer match, which likely explains the duplicate suppression entries reported Tuesday. Please reconcile before the Thursday cut. For reference, the currently deployed configuration on the live node reads as follows.

config for yajep-yahof:
[briax]
port = 9200
region = outer-2
host = briax.nelvrocorp.test
team = raleth
timeout_ms = 1500
retries = 1

Step 4: Swap the renderer. The legacy Quillmark pipeline sanitized HTML after rendering; the new Fernpress engine sanitizes before and after, and raw HTML passthrough is disabled by default. For your review: no user-supplied input reaches the template layer, and all link schemes are allowlisted. Embedded math and diagrams now render in a sandboxed worker with no network access. Rollback is a single flag flip, retained for two releases. The renderer reads its hardening settings from the block below.

service settings:
druael:
  log_level: debug
  metrics_host: metrics.druael.zemvarlabs.internal
  pool_size: 16